Cleaner and Healthier Indoor Air

Removal of Air Pollutants

An air purifier is a valuable appliance that helps remove air pollutants from your indoor environment. These pollutants can include dust, pet dander, pollen, mold spores, and other microscopic particles that can negatively impact your health. By capturing and eliminating these harmful substances, an air purifier ensures that the air you breathe inside your home is cleaner and free from potentially dangerous pollutants.

Reduced Allergy Symptoms

If you suffer from allergies, an air purifier can provide significant relief. By removing common allergens like pollen and dust mites from the air, it helps reduce the triggers that can cause allergy symptoms. With cleaner air circulating throughout your home, you may experience a decrease in sneezing, itching, congestion, and other discomforts associated with allergies.

Removal of Unpleasant Odors

Elimination of Pet Odors

If you have pets, you’re probably familiar with the challenge of lingering pet odors. Air purifiers equipped with activated carbon filters are effective at removing pet odors from the air, ensuring a fresher and more pleasant-smelling home. Say goodbye to that pet smell and enjoy a cleaner, odor-free indoor environment.

Elimination of Cooking Smells

While cooking can create delicious aromas, it can also leave behind lingering odors. An air purifier with a carbon filter can effectively eliminate cooking smells, ensuring that your home remains free from unpleasant odors. Enjoy the benefits of a freshly cooked meal without having to worry about odors permeating your living space.

Removal of Tobacco Smell

If you or someone in your household smokes, an air purifier can help eliminate the smell of tobacco from your indoor air. Smoke particles and odor molecules can cling to furniture, walls, and fabrics, making it challenging to get rid of the smell. However, with an air purifier containing a combination of filters designed to capture and neutralize odors, you can enjoy a smoke-free environment.

Protection for Babies and Young Children

Elimination of Harmful VOCs

Volatile Organic Compounds (VOCs) can be found in various household products, including cleaning solutions, paints, and furniture. These chemicals can have adverse effects on the health of babies and young children, who are more susceptible to their toxic properties. Air purifiers equipped with activated carbon filters effectively capture and neutralize VOCs, ensuring safer indoor air for your little ones.
